Why does Norwich face distinct water damage challenges compared to other parts of New York State or the Northeast? The answer lies in its climate, geography, and documented history of water-related disasters. Norwich experiences an annual precipitation total of about 45.3 inches, which exceeds many U.S. regions—some of which average closer to 30-40 inches annually. This higher moisture level, combined with its location in a northeast coastal climate zone, creates conditions ripe for specific water damage risks such as nor’easters, ice dams, and flooding.
Chenango County, where Norwich is situated, has endured 16 federally declared water-related disasters, underscoring that severe water events are not anomalies but recurring threats. The region’s vulnerability includes freezing temperatures that lead to pipe bursts when heating systems falter or insulation is inadequate. Ice dams form on pitched roofs during winter thaw-freeze cycles, allowing meltwater to seep beneath shingles and into ceilings. Additionally, spring snowmelt often saturates soil and overwhelms drainage systems, contributing to basement flooding in low-lying areas.
Norwich’s position near coastal flood zones adds another layer of risk during extreme storms. Though it is inland relative to Long Island or New York City, nor’easters can generate heavy rain and strong winds that cause localized flooding and structural damage. Unlike areas with predominantly warm climates where flash floods are the main concern, Norwich's combination of coastal storm impacts and cold weather introduces a dual hazard profile. This means that homeowners here face challenges from both freezing-related damage and flooding, requiring diverse preparedness strategies.
Understanding these local factors helps residents grasp why common water damage advice may not fully apply. For instance, pipe insulation and heat maintenance are critical in winter, while roof inspection and gutter clearing become priorities ahead of fall storms. Recognizing the documented pattern of water disasters in Chenango County reinforces the need for vigilance and tailored prevention efforts to reduce the frequency and severity of water intrusion incidents.

Imagine a home in Norwich with original plumbing pipes slowly corroding beneath the floorboards, unnoticed until a small leak turns into a basement flood. This scenario is common here because the median year of home construction is 1963. Many houses in the area are now over 55 years old, a period when original plumbing, roofing, and waterproofing materials often reach the end of their effective service life. The risk of pipe ruptures, foundation seepage, and roof leaks rises significantly in these aging structures.
Approximately 64.6 percent of Norwich’s housing stock consists of single-family homes, many built before modern building codes and materials were widely adopted. Homes constructed prior to 1980 often contain galvanized steel water supply lines prone to rust and clogging, while cast iron drain pipes—common before 1970—are susceptible to cracking and blockage. These material vulnerabilities increase the likelihood of sudden water intrusion events that require professional mitigation. Furthermore, older roofing materials may lack adequate ice dam resistance, especially relevant in this northern climate.
Mobile and manufactured homes represent about 20.5 percent of the housing here. These dwellings frequently face unique water damage vulnerabilities due to their construction and siting. For instance, limited elevation can cause water to pool beneath the home during heavy rains, while lighter framing materials might suffer structural weakening when exposed to persistent moisture. Connections such as plumbing joints and electrical conduits in these homes often require more frequent inspection and maintenance to prevent leaks and hazards.
Multi-unit buildings, which make up nearly 15 percent of the local housing, introduce additional complexities. Shared plumbing systems and adjacent walls mean that a leak in one unit can quickly affect others, compounding damage and complicating liability and repair logistics. This interconnectedness demands prompt attention and coordination among residents and landlords. Overall, Norwich’s aging and diverse housing stock presents a mosaic of water damage risks that homeowners and renters must navigate with awareness and preventive care.

How much does water damage repair typically cost in Norwich, and how does that impact local homeowners? To answer this, examining typical damage severity tiers alongside the city’s economic context provides a clearer picture. Minor damage starts at around $900 but can reach as high as $3,600. Moderate restoration efforts generally run from $3,600 up to $10,700, while major repairs can escalate between $10,700 and $35,600. Given that the median home value in Norwich is about $131,604, a worst-case scenario requiring $35,600 represents approximately 27 percent of a typical property’s worth—a substantial financial burden in this community.
This cost structure reflects Norwich’s local economic conditions, where the median household income hovers near $53,333. A high-end major restoration bill equates to roughly eight months’ earnings for the average family, emphasizing the importance of early detection and prompt mitigation. The local cost multiplier of 0.71 compared to national averages indicates that labor and materials may be somewhat less expensive here than elsewhere, yet even moderate damages can quickly become unmanageable without assistance or insurance support.
A common scenario in Norwich involves roof leaks triggered by nor’easters or ice dam formation during winter. For example, a slow leak under shingles can saturate attic insulation and wooden framing before being noticed, eventually causing structural damage and mold growth. Repair costs escalate as more extensive removal and drying become necessary. Likewise, plumbing failures such as a ruptured washing machine hose in an older home built in the 1960s—typical in Norwich—can flood basements, requiring sump pump repair and water extraction. These examples reflect how climate and housing stock interact to influence restoration expenses locally.
Despite potentially daunting figures, many Norwich residents find minor repairs manageable, and taking action early often prevents escalation into costlier emergencies. Payment options, financial assistance programs, and insurance claims can also help spread out expenses. Understanding the cost ranges and local housing dynamics equips homeowners to make informed decisions about when to address water damage independently and when to seek specialized help to protect their investment and well-being.

Norwich’s water damage risks follow a distinctly seasonal rhythm shaped by its northeast coastal climate. From November through April, cold temperatures bring heightened danger of frozen pipes and ice dams. During these months, homeowners should prioritize insulating exposed plumbing and ensuring heating systems maintain steady warmth in vulnerable areas. Ice dams, which develop as snow melts unevenly on roofs, can force water beneath shingles, damaging ceilings and walls. Cleaning gutters and installing roof heating cables are effective preventative steps in this period.
The late summer and early fall months—August through October—also signal a spike in water damage risk due to storm activity, including nor’easters and tropical remnants that can bring heavy rains and flooding. During this season, clearing debris from storm drains and reinforcing basement waterproofing can mitigate infiltration. Preparing sump pumps and verifying their functionality before peak storm season helps reduce prolonged water exposure.
Spring brings its own set of challenges. Melting snow combined with seasonal rainfall often saturates soil, elevating the risk of basement seepage and foundation leaks. While freeze-related concerns wane, homeowners should inspect drainage patterns around their homes and ensure downspouts direct water away from foundations. Early spring is an ideal time to assess and repair cracks in basement walls and verify sump pump operability.
Even the summer months, though generally lower risk, are not free from water intrusion threats. Occasional thunderstorms can overload drainage systems, and high indoor humidity levels encourage mold growth in areas previously affected by water. Using dehumidifiers and maintaining ventilation help address these ongoing concerns. By aligning prevention efforts with Norwich’s seasonal water damage trends, residents can better safeguard their properties throughout the year.

Data from restoration professionals indicates that water damage costing beyond approximately $900 typically signals the need for expert intervention in Norwich. When water begins to pool significantly in living spaces or when damage extends past a single room, the complexity grows rapidly. For example, if a washing machine hose bursts and floods adjacent storage areas or if HVAC condensation leads to moisture buildup affecting electrical systems, relying on industrial-grade drying equipment and technical expertise becomes essential. Similarly, if sewage contamination or contact with electrical wiring is involved, the risk to health and safety increases.
Homeowners should also consider professional assistance if visible water does not evaporate or dry out within a day or two, as lingering moisture can foster mold growth and structural degradation. Professionals certified by the Institute of Inspection, Cleaning and Restoration Certification (IICRC) possess specialized training to assess hidden damage and prevent secondary problems. Their access to high-capacity air movers, dehumidifiers, and moisture meters ensures thorough remediation that DIY efforts often cannot achieve.
